
General purpose optocoupler featuring a transistor output. Offers 5.3kV isolation voltage and a 70V collector-emitter breakdown voltage. Operates with a 60mA forward current and provides up to 50mA output current per channel. Housed in a PDIP package for through-hole mounting, with a maximum power dissipation of 250mW. Suitable for operation across a -55°C to 100°C temperature range.
